Philip A. LaBastie, 83, of Mendon
1943 - 2026

Philip A. LaBastie, 83, of Mendon, passed away peacefully on Monday, September 7th, 2026, following a courageous battle with cancer. He was the beloved husband of the late Madeline Rita (Couture) LaBastie.

Born on February 14th, 1943, Philip was the son of the late Austin and Augusta (Princepessa) LaBastie of Mendon. He was a graduate of Saint Mary’s High School in Milford, Class of 1960, and proudly served his country as an Air Force veteran.

Following his military service, Philip began a long and dedicated career with Rosenfeld Concrete, where he worked for more than 30 years as a Maintenance Supervisor. He was known for his strong work ethic, mechanical skills, and dedication to his profession.

Outside of work, Philip found great joy in racing and working with his hands. He took great pride in his years as a circle track racer, competing in car #45 at Westborough Speedway alongside his good friend Sully Tinio. He also cherished the opportunity to work on a race car with his son Chad, creating lasting memories through their shared passion for racing.

Philip was a proud member of Teamsters Local #170 of Worcester and enjoyed riding his Harley-Davidson motorcycle, working around the family farm with his brother, and spending time with family and friends. He was a longtime member of St. Gabriel’s Parish in Upton.
